As Harness Roofing expanded its operations and added employees across multiple locations, keeping everyone connected became increasingly important.
Today, the company supports more than 175 Windows desktops and laptops across offices and home offices throughout the country. And with employees working from different locations, the IT team needed a reliable way to provide support without spending valuable time traveling between sites.
Before remote access became part of the company’s daily operations, troubleshooting often meant trying to diagnose issues over the phone. And as anyone who has ever provided IT support remotely can attest, what starts as a simple issue can quickly turn into a game of twenty questions, with valuable time lost before anyone gets to the root of the problem.
At the same time, managers and executives were collaborating on estimates, bids, and project approvals that couldn’t always wait for in-person meetings. And when project managers encountered issues on active job sites, they needed help right away rather than waiting for someone to travel to them.
As the business continued to grow, the need became clear: employees needed access to fast support and seamless collaboration no matter where they were working.

Harness Roofing first adopted RealVNC around 2004. What started as a way for IT to remotely access employee devices quickly evolved into something much bigger.
Rather than spending time trying to interpret a problem second-hand, the IT team could connect directly, identify the root cause, and get employees back up and running. And because users could watch issues being resolved in real time, support sessions often doubled as informal training opportunities.
Over time, employees became more confident using company applications, while the IT team spent less time addressing repeat issues.
The benefits soon extended beyond technical support.
Managers used RealVNC to review estimates, discuss bids, and collaborate with colleagues across locations. And executives could participate in important decisions without needing to be in the same office. When questions came up around active projects, teams could connect immediately and keep work moving forward.

"One of the reasons we chose RealVNC was its responsiveness during photo reviews. Our COO frequently connects remotely to review project and inspection photos as part of the estimating process, sometimes flipping through 80 or more images in a single session.
With RealVNC, each photo appears almost instantly as he moves through the image set. Other remote-access and screen-sharing solutions we evaluated introduced noticeable lag when displaying the next photo, which made the review process frustrating.
RealVNC provided a much smoother experience and allowed him to review large numbers of photos efficiently from a remote location."
Tim Harness, IT Administrator, Harness Roofing
